Burrard Bridge comparisons part two

My last post talked about the traffic management issues that, at one level, illustrate why the Burrard St. Bridge is not a good model for critics promoting a "two lane solution" for our own Blue Bridge.  I've added a few more pics and some commentary at my flickr site to illustrate further some of the engineering challenges that should add another nail to that coffin.

Burrard has more width to work with and the separated bike lane has been installed using concrete barriers to provide some distance between cyclists and fast moving traffic.  The facility is designed to provide single direction bike lanes, with the east side sidewalk converted to bicycle only use and pedestrians assigned the west side sidewalk on the bridge.  This will prevent conflict in the confined space on the bridge, something that would be a serious problem if the bike lane was two-way or worse, multi-use, an idea that has been suggested by critics looking for "solutions" to save the Blue Bridge.  Some may profess an interest only in providing a substitute for the loss of acces to the now closed rail bridge for cyclists and pedestrians, but I believe that many are simply looking again to find some way to demonstrate that a "solution" exists that would allow the city to save the bridge while providing improvements for cyclists and pedestrians.

The photos should provide some food for thought on how much more constrained we would be on the Johnson St. Bridge, as compared to Burrard, where we have lanes that are narrower and the functional needs of a movable bridge can't accommodate the significant additional weight of an effective barrier system.

The need for robust separation would be particularly acute if a two-way or multi-use lane were to be contemplated.  While daylight is generous through spring and summer and into early fall, commute times across the bridge will be cloaked in darkness for many months of the year and bicycles in particular, riding against the flow of traffic on the bridge, would need some signficant separation from opposing traffic and blinding lights.  Engineering standards for multi-use or two way facilities adjacent to roadways demand more space than would be available on the Johnson St. Bridge where a standard dimension "jersey barrier" would rob at least two feet from the separated lane.

It's another example of where the math doesn't work.  The city's response so far has been to strengthen the visual cues for drivers to slow down and share the road across the bridge, and to encourage cyclists to "take the lane" to ensure safe passage.  It is a safer and more effective way of calming traffic and providing an adequate, if not ideal, level of service for everyone who will be using the bridge over the next 3 1/2 years while we work on our replacement structure.

Back to basics on the bridge

Last week the rail span of the Johnson St. Bridge was closed for safety reasons.  The rail stopped using it a few weeks ago and service has been suspended, at least temporarily, while the Island Corridor Foundation that owns the rail line scrambles to find funding for track fixes well beyond the bridge.

While the bridge may have been safe for cyclists and pedestrians to use for awhile longer, perhaps a few weeks or a month, the prudent approach was to accept the advice of the engineers of record and close the bridge.  It's a cautious approach and ensures life safety issues are addressed, protecting our citizens (as well as reducing our exposure to liability issues should the bridge fail without warning).

We're ahead of the game here, not so much like Minneapolis where the I-35 bridge collapsed in 2007, killing 13 and injuring dozens more.  I've covered that one elsewhere in the blog or on my website.

What's got me back on the bridge is the rise again of what I believed to have been a dead issue.  More than one council colleague raised the prospect of closing one lane to provide some separation for cyclists and, I think for some, the idea that it could be shared with pedestrians.  More on some of the design challenges in some blogs in the days to come, but first I wanted to address one of the flippant comments made during our discussion of what to do.  So far, a lot has been done already, with signage and on-road improvements to remind everyone to slow down and share the road while we wait for the new bridge.  Most cyclists I've talked to are very enthusiastic about the rapid response and the effectiveness of the new treatments in making their commute a little more comfortable.

More than once though, I've heard, to my frustration (and expressed in most unparliamentary language), that "they can do it on the Burrard St. Bridge so we can do it here" for one, or  "we took a lane away on Fort St. and it works there so it can work on our bridge".  Neither comparison stands up, however and you can find some photo links here that illustrate some of the differences.  Traffic operations don't lend themselves to simplistic solutions and misplaced comparisons.

The volume, lane capacity and intersection dynamics, particularly on the downtown side of our Blue Bridge will break down if we close a lane, not to mention, yet, all the other design problems of viewing the bridge in isolation from the surrounding road and sidewalk network.

The Burrard St. Bridge, by way of comparison, has six lanes to our three, but more to the point, when the bike lane pilot was introduced, lane capacity was cut by a third (taking one of three outbound lanes is the important factor to understand), while proposals for the Blue Bridge would take away half the capacity available for outbound traffic - and in close proximity to nearby downtown intersections, and those feeding, steadily, five lanes of traffic into the bridge.  (The single inbound lane is the opposite - it feeds several lanes so has all the relief it needs from congestion pressures, not to mention a long approach where vehicles can store if traffic is busy or, what is another key to our crossing, when the bridge is up and all traffic is stopped).

Here's what Burrard used to look like - and you can count the lanes.  It's just not like our bridge and not a useful comparison.  The math doesn't add up.

Fort St., another project used for comparison also doesn't add up for our bridge.  It's still 3 lanes, allowing for some traffic to be drained off to left turns during peak hours, and carrying about a quarter to a third less traffic than is using the blue bridge.  Again, the math doesn't work.  Here's a quiet moment on Fort.

And here's where the traffic that uses the bridge fits into the road dynamics on the west side.  It's useful in understanding how and why traffic keeps moving over the bridge through Vic West and into Esquimalt in afternoon peak hours.  The math should be pretty clear.  It's not something that would fit on the bridge itself, let alone the nearby street grid on the downtown side.  Intersections are too close, and feeding too much traffic onto the bridge to make it work.

Latest on the Blue Bridge

While the chatter coming from various directions, promoted ad nauseum by some, that there are cheap and easy fixes that will save the old Blue Bridge, ongoing work by the city and its consultants continue to find evidence to the contrary.

With the new bridge project underway, though mostly on paper at this stage (design details), keeping the old bridge safe enough to serve for another three years remains a task at hand.  Rust never sleeps, of course, nowhere more so than on the wet coast, sitting astride a salt water harbour where the wind blows and the sea wash filter through the old structure.  Compromised rivets pop up like measles on a two year old.  Fixes will be more robust than band aids and bailing wire but the analogy is not too far from a harsh reality.

City staff and engineering consultants were out on the bridge Sunday, the 27th of March, chipping away at concrete to analyze rivet conditions along the steel members encased by the concrete counterweights - something no one has been able to look at for almost 90 years.

Starker still are unique points of failure that will be repeated throughout the superstructure.  Everwhere where there are rivets under stress, allowing salt water mositure to seep in between sandwich plates of cheap steel,  the integrity of bridge beams are increasingly being compromised.  Close examination of the interconnectedness of every part of the machine should dispel any notion of a complete and durable refurbishment without taking the entire structure apart.

Trying to do it on site would turn the Inner Harbour into a tailings pond.  A point of reference for marina opponents is the potential environmental impacts on the harbour from construction and operations, not to mention the disenfrachisement of people powered craft that enjoy the northwest shores of the harbour.  Those are very valid concerns.  By comparison, even repainting the bridge on site, a logistical nightmare on any movable bridge, and most problematic on bascule structures, would pose untold risks to the marine environment.  Look closely at what is already shedding and the concern should become apparent.

One recent letter to the editor promoted the fiction that we didn't do our homework on the bridge.  It's still a work in progress, but as the project moves forward we continue to confirm that the original findings of our condtion assessments have been followed by prudent and sustainable decisions.

Green and the economy

No surprise that the federal government is underperforming in the creation of jobs for the future.  While we continue to float above some of the rest of western economies on a sea of oil, building a more sustainable future at all levels, doesn't seem to be on the Harper agenda.

We have locally taken some of the stimulus funding to create our own green infrastructure, so credit is due to the feds for the investment in our Johnson St. Bridge project.  The new bridge will improve conditions for cycling and walking dramatically, inviting people to shift their trips to more sustainable modes. 

Still there is more to the green economy that our transportation systems design, and we have other initiatives underway that should help us meet environmental objectives, particularly reductions in greenhouse gas emissions.  Elements of our sewage treatment options for the Capital Region include, potentially, recovering heat from waste and distributing it through a district energy system - one plant or heat source for many buildings and businesses.

If the energy centre comes to Victoria, we could link the system to yet to be developed brownfield sites at Rock Bay in the Upper Harbour area.  One of the directions we have been investigating might be to target the neighbourhood for a hi-tech park that would cluster knowledge and skills in a near downtown location and use the heat and energy from wastewater treatment to help support the industry.  The more central location would invite, as well, more sustainable travel choices and support greening of our local, light industrial sector.  At this point, it's an idea, not yet a plan, but something worth exploring further as various projects come into focus.

One of the initiatives the city has undertaken of late is to sign on with Mayor Gregor Robertson of Vancouver and Mike McGinn in a "Cascadia" sustainability initiative to try and attract complementary green business and industry to the northwest.  Kudos to Victoria Mayor Fortin for leading the charge on behalf of the city.

Hi-tech is already our biggest industry locally - it generates more dollars than tourism and other industries usually seen as staples of Victoria's economy.  Hi-tech is a fluid, mobile industry, and not just the clean energy supports will be important to attracting business.  The things we are doing to support active transportation - cycling and walking, and an active, outdoors lifestyle, are big attractions to businesses that can locate anywhere.  Building a better transit system will need to happen too.

The future of our region, economically and environmentally, will depend on how we respond to the climate change challenge and on the social ledger, creating a vibrant place to live, invest and work will also help us to address the other account on our triple bottom line.  It's something every level of government needs to tackle with us.

Something for drivers

Car insurance by the mile (or kilometer) is something that would benefit drivers who use their cars irregularly.  It's an idea promoted locally by Todd Litman of the Victoria Transport Policy Institute (http://www.vtpi.org/).  An incentive to use cars in moderation, mileage based insurance may be coming to Washington State in the U.S.  A bill introduced in the state legislature aims to remove barriers to introducing a plan.

Distance based insurance could encourage people to think before they drive - asking themselves if they really need a vehicle for any particular trip.  I drive my wife's car on occasion, but for most trips I bike.  It's habit, and a good one at that.  Helping people to make more sustainable decisions is good public policy, and the plan should be embraced by ICBC (the Insurance Corporation of British Columbia), which supplies our public, mandatory auto insurance in B.C.

Train in Vain

The Esquimalt and Nanaimo Railway is still open for business, but efforts to keep the trains running could be threatened by the competiton for funding aimed at improving transit for Greater Victoria.

BC Transit is focused on the West Shore - Uptown - Downtown axis, desiging an alignment that would run along the Trans Canada Highway between Langford and the Uptown Mall, and then along Douglas St. to downtown Victoria.  While the public, (at least those paying attention to the project), strongly supports LRT (Light Rail Transit), provincial managers have favoured BRT (Bus Rapid Transit) in developing plans for the system.  The strong community support for LRT has lately brought Transit on board and more detailed work on the rail option is being undertaken.

Public enthusiasm may be tempered by the capital costs of LRT - it will take longer to implement and have a much higher initial cost than a bus system, but the many benefits of a rail based system may yet persuade decision makers to start planning now rather than waiting the 10 years or so when some planners suggest Victoria will be ready for LRT.  Why spend extra money on a short lived bus based system when the need for rail is visible on the horizon?

The challenge for the E&N is that its potential is more distant and the costs associated with upgrading the heavy rail system more forbidding.  A phased approach and incremental financing to get some useful service improvements have been proposed, but the longer term costs are still daunting. 

Still, the rail has the potential to fill some key service gaps that have not been entirely accounted for in transit planning.  Hundreds of commuters could take advantage of a commuter rail (not LRT) service that covered the long haul from Nanaimo through the Cowichan Valley and right to the door of the Canadian Forces Base at Esquimalt.  It could  help relieve some congestion on the Malahat Drive - a 350 metre high climb on the Trans Canada Highway separating Victoria from points north on the Island.  The Malahat already suffers heavy commuter traffic and sometimes winter weather clogs up the highway.  A well run E&N could offer relief for growing numbers of commuters living out of the transit region and accessible to the railway.

The $500 million calculated several years ago for improvements to the Malahat makes rail and transit alternatives look a lot more affordable; but tight funding and a focus on Vancouver area projects leaves little to invest in Greater Victoria's transportation challenges.

It's an unfortunate state of affairs, as crunch time is here for the little railway.  Victoria's Johnson St. Bridge project is a case in point.  $12 million is needed to keep rail on the bridge, something that would better commuter rail's chance of success.  So far, $15 million in costs have been identified elsewhere for the rail as far as Langford, and that only to achieve minimal standards for a modest commuter service.  Anything beyond that, either geographically or in terms of service levels, can be expected to add more to the bill.

It's costly, but is it worth the investment?  Certainly many of us in the community think so, but for Victoria in particular, the rail on the bridge might be a bill too big to swallow.  We've asked repeatedly for provincial assistance, without success, and have now appealed to the Capital Regional District - our services partnership with other local governments.  Apprehension exists around that table so the request for funding, although supported by the Mayors of numbers of affected communities, has met with less enthusiasm around some council tables and may face a rough ride at the regional board.

Victoria cannot, by itself, foot the entire bill.  We are already in for $50 million and the clock is ticking.  We need to get on with our schedule or face the prospect of losing $21 million in federal funding or missing construction deadlines.  We all want to see rail come to town, but clearly it is a regional service that needs regional support.  The rail doesn't run from downtown to Vic West, a few hundred metres away - it runs half way up the Island, and most pointedly, through several suburban municipalities who are now being asked to help out.  If they aren't now willing to invest in key elements of the rail corridor, what does it say about their commitment to the rest of the line?

Stay tuned.  If the money can be found, rail stays in the design.  If not, we can preserve the right of way but can't build the rail bridge right away.  It's an expensive decision either way - it's too costly for our taxpayers, but for everyone, a separate project will cost much more.  If we want the rail to survice, we'll all need to pitch in.  Here's hoping.

Guaranteed incomes and social outcomes

Carol Goar of the Toronto Star writes here about the 1970s "Mincome" experiment in Manitoba under Ed Schreyer's NDP and with the support of the federal government.  Guaranteeing incomes in a small community had numbers of positive outcomes for the community.  Goar notes, however, that a report on the experiment has never been written but research gleans from hard to get documents in Ottawa point to the program's success.
